Tonye Cole claims PDP thugs attacked him at INEC Office

Tonye Cole, an All Progressives Congress (APC) candidate for governor of Rivers State in the March 18 election, has alleged that the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) sent thugs to attack him and his team on Monday in order to prevent them from entering the INEC office in Port Harcourt.

The PDP candidate, Siminialayi Fubara, was declared the winner of the race, but Cole said he and other party leaders were beaten by thugs who had reportedly been dispatched by the PDP while trying to get election paperwork for a petition to protest the decision.

Speaking to newsmen in Port Harcourt, Cole said he was assaulted by thugs whom he said pelted him with water, food, and stones until he got injured.
